Skip to content

Commit bffa746

Browse files
committed
Merge branch 'master' into truffle-head
2 parents 69d8085 + 17f9ce5 commit bffa746

File tree

91 files changed

+1740
-1347
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

91 files changed

+1740
-1347
lines changed

.gitignore

+1-1
Original file line numberDiff line numberDiff line change
@@ -48,7 +48,7 @@ lib/ruby/stdlib/jar*
4848
lib/ruby/stdlib/jline
4949
lib/ruby/stdlib/jopenssl*
5050
lib/ruby/stdlib/krypt*
51-
lib/ruby/stdlib/openssl
51+
lib/ruby/stdlib/openssl*
5252
lib/ruby/stdlib/org/
5353
lib/ruby/stdlib/readline/*readline*.jar
5454
lib/ruby/stdlib/ripper.jar

antlib/extra.xml

+5-5
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 build jruby-complete.jar
2525
<env key='GEM_PATH' value='lib/ruby/gems/shared'/>
2626
<arg value='-Djruby.home=uri:classloader://META-INF/jruby.home'/>
2727
<arg value='-cp'/>
28-
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.20-SNAPSHOT.jar'/>
28+
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.21-SNAPSHOT.jar'/>
2929
<arg value='org.jruby.Main'/>
3030
<arg value='-I.:test/externals/ruby1.9:test/externals/ruby1.9/ruby'/>
3131
<arg value='-r./test/ruby19_env.rb'/>
@@ -136,7 +136,7 @@ build jruby-complete.jar
136136
<env key='GEM_PATH' value='lib/ruby/gems/shared'/>
137137
<arg value='-Djruby.home=uri:classloader://META-INF/jruby.home'/>
138138
<arg value='-cp'/>
139-
<arg value='core/target/test-classes:test/target/test-classes:maven/jruby-complete/target/jruby-complete-1.7.20-SNAPSHOT.jar'/>
139+
<arg value='core/target/test-classes:test/target/test-classes:maven/jruby-complete/target/jruby-complete-1.7.21-SNAPSHOT.jar'/>
140140
<arg value='org.jruby.Main'/>
141141
<arg value='-I.:test/externals/ruby1.9:test/externals/ruby1.9/ruby'/>
142142
<arg value='-r./test/ruby19_env.rb'/>
@@ -152,7 +152,7 @@ build jruby-complete.jar
152152
<env key='GEM_PATH' value='lib/ruby/gems/shared'/>
153153
<arg value='-Djruby.home=uri:classloader://META-INF/jruby.home'/>
154154
<arg value='-cp'/>
155-
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.20-SNAPSHOT.jar'/>
155+
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.21-SNAPSHOT.jar'/>
156156
<arg value='org.jruby.Main'/>
157157
<arg value='-I.:test/externals/ruby1.9:test/externals/ruby1.9/ruby'/>
158158
<arg value='-r./test/ruby19_env.rb'/>
@@ -168,7 +168,7 @@ build jruby-complete.jar
168168
<env key='GEM_PATH' value='lib/ruby/gems/shared'/>
169169
<arg value='-Djruby.home=uri:classloader://META-INF/jruby.home'/>
170170
<arg value='-cp'/>
171-
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.20-SNAPSHOT.jar'/>
171+
<arg value='core/target/test-classes:test/target/test-classes:lib/jruby.jar:maven/jruby-stdlib/target/jruby-stdlib-1.7.21-SNAPSHOT.jar'/>
172172
<arg value='org.jruby.Main'/>
173173
<arg value='-I.:test/externals/ruby1.9:test/externals/ruby1.9/ruby'/>
174174
<arg value='-r./test/ruby19_env.rb'/>
@@ -460,7 +460,7 @@ build jruby-complete.jar
460460
<env key='GEM_PATH' value='lib/ruby/gems/shared'/>
461461
<arg value='-Djruby.home=uri:classloader://META-INF/jruby.home'/>
462462
<arg value='-cp'/>
463-
<arg value='core/target/test-classes:test/target/test-classes:maven/jruby-complete/target/jruby-complete-1.7.20-SNAPSHOT.jar'/>
463+
<arg value='core/target/test-classes:test/target/test-classes:maven/jruby-complete/target/jruby-complete-1.7.21-SNAPSHOT.jar'/>
464464
<arg value='org.jruby.Main'/>
465465
<arg value='-I.:test/externals/ruby1.9:test/externals/ruby1.9/ruby'/>
466466
<arg value='-r./test/ruby19_env.rb'/>

core/pom.xml

+3
Original file line numberDiff line numberDiff line change
@@ -91,6 +91,7 @@
9191
<groupId>com.github.jnr</groupId>
9292
<artifactId>jnr-enxio</artifactId>
9393
<version>0.9</version>
94+
<type>jar</type>
9495
</dependency>
9596
<dependency>
9697
<groupId>com.github.jnr</groupId>
@@ -101,6 +102,7 @@
101102
<groupId>com.github.jnr</groupId>
102103
<artifactId>jnr-unixsocket</artifactId>
103104
<version>0.8</version>
105+
<type>jar</type>
104106
</dependency>
105107
<dependency>
106108
<groupId>com.github.jnr</groupId>
@@ -116,6 +118,7 @@
116118
<groupId>com.github.jnr</groupId>
117119
<artifactId>jnr-ffi</artifactId>
118120
<version>2.0.3</version>
121+
<type>jar</type>
119122
</dependency>
120123
<dependency>
121124
<groupId>com.github.jnr</groupId>

core/src/main/java/org/jruby/Ruby.java

+1-1
Original file line numberDiff line numberDiff line change
@@ -1288,7 +1288,7 @@ && getInstanceConfig().getCompileMode() != CompileMode.TRUFFLE) {
12881288
// attempt to enable unlimited-strength crypto on OpenJDK
12891289
try {
12901290
Class jceSecurity = Class.forName("javax.crypto.JceSecurity");
1291-
Field isRestricted = jceSecurity.getField("isRestricted");
1291+
Field isRestricted = jceSecurity.getDeclaredField("isRestricted");
12921292
isRestricted.setAccessible(true);
12931293
isRestricted.set(null, false);
12941294
isRestricted.setAccessible(false);

0 commit comments

Comments
 (0)